Student Veterans of America Jobs

Welcome to SVA’s jobs portal, your one-stop shop for finding the most up to date source of employment opportunities. We have partnered with the National Labor Exchange to provide you this information. You may be looking for part-time employment to supplement your income while you are in school. You might be looking for an internship to add experience to your resume. And you may be completing your training ready to start a new career. This site has all of those types of jobs.

Here are a few things you should know:
  • This site is mobile friendly. You do not need a log-in or password to access information.
  • Jobs on this site are original and unduplicated and come from three sources: the Federal government, state workforce agency job banks, and corporate career websites. All jobs are vetted to ensure there are no scams, training schemes, or phishing.
  • The site is refreshed daily to remove out-of-date content.
  • The newest jobs are listed first, so use the search features to match your interests. You can look for jobs in a specific geographical location, by title or keyword, or you can use the military crosswalk. You may want to do something different from your military career, but you undoubtedly have skills from that occupation that match to a civilian job.

JPMorgan Chase Lead Software Engineer - Cloud Engineer - AWS in Plano, Texas

You will work within a team, engaging with Product team members to help build and reinforce the Cloud mindset and to embed cloud practices in the day to day work. Examples include creating the design infrastructure for new features on the cloud, Infrastructure as code, best database to use in the scenario, cost-optimized infrastructure choices, security as day zero practice and attaining dark data center as a principal.

As a Lead Software Engineer at JPMorgan Chase within the Cloud Services team, you will be instrumental in fostering a cloud-centric mindset and integrating cloud practices into daily operations. Your responsibilities will encompass designing infrastructure for new cloud features, implementing Infrastructure as Code, determining the most suitable database for given scenarios, making cost-effective infrastructure decisions, prioritizing security from the outset, and striving to achieve a dark data center as a fundamental principle.

Job responsibilities

  • Some of the things that you can look forward to doing once you are here are:

  • Be part of Agile rituals like Feature elaboration/Estimation, daily stand-ups, release planning, Iteration Planning Meeting, Retrospective, Showcase, etc

  • Maintain Product Infrastructure using reusable clean code and one-click deployment methodologies.Creating technical design specs for a multi-region across availability zone deployments.

  • Work on clustering strategies of NoSQL Databases and implementing the latest features by rolling upgrades ensuring higher availability.

  • Create testing platforms for the Infrastructure code for ensuring high availability using the unit and regression tests for infrastructure code.

  • Making sure that security is the most important part of the product and compliances like PCI and all are maintained, and tests are performed.

  • Writing libraries and plugins for the open-source products and tools used by the team using Python, C#, Java, etc.

  • Evaluate the latest technology releases and ensure that the Product is always at the best to use Platform.

  • Gate keep development process and quality by ensuring that best practices are followed.

  • Coach, train and mentor to improve the maturity and value of the cloud practices within the team.

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Formal training or certification on software engineering concepts and 5+ years applied experience

  • Should have been working for at least four years as a DevOps/Cloud Engineer.

  • Should have worked on AWS Cloud services like compute, storage, databases, network,

  • application integration, monitoring & alerting, Identity & Access Management.Should have been working in an Infrastructure as code environment or understands it very clearly.

  • Should have done Infrastructure coding using Cloud Formation/Terraform and Configuration Management using Chef/Ansible.

  • Hands-on experience of working on containers and its orchestration using Kubernetes.

  • Has good knowledge and understanding of Network Security, Security Architecture and Secured SDLC practices

  • Should have worked on NoSQL Databases like Cassandra, Aerospike, MongoDB, DynamoDB or Couchbase

  • Central Logging, monitoring using stacks like ELK(Elastic) on the cloud, Grafana, Prometheus, etc.

  • Should have worked on creating CI/CD pipelines using one or more tools (Jenkins,Bamboo or Circle CI)

  • Should have worked on two or more Scripting languages (Python/Shell/Ruby)

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Having some background or coursework in Computer Science

  • AWS certifications, Kubernetes certification or the likes.

  • Relevant experience in a product organization

  • AWS security services like Guard Duty, Inspector, Cognito, WAF & Shield.

  • Worked on one or more Programming language (preferably Java or C#)

  • Worked on infrastructure design and implementation of serverless applications.

  • Should have ease in understanding Shell/PowerShell and Bash scripts for the default libraries of OS
